2. Paint Sort

Paint sort considerably influences the amount required for automotive portray. Completely different paint formulations possess various protection charges and utility necessities, straight impacting the general quantity wanted. Understanding these variations is essential for correct estimation and environment friendly materials utilization.

  • Stable Colours

    Stable shade paints sometimes require much less quantity in comparison with metallic or pearlescent finishes. Their easier pigment construction permits for larger opacity, usually reaching full protection with fewer coats. This interprets to decrease general paint consumption, making them a cheap selection. For instance, a single-stage strong shade may obtain full protection in two coats, whereas a metallic base coat/clear coat system may require a number of base coats and two or extra clear coats.

  • Metallic Paints

    Metallic paints, containing small steel flakes, necessitate a better quantity as a consequence of their decrease opacity. Attaining a uniform, constant look usually requires further coats, rising the entire paint wanted. That is significantly noticeable on bigger automobiles the place even minor inconsistencies in metallic flake distribution turn into readily obvious. Moreover, the precise sort of metallic flake, comparable to aluminum or gold, can additional affect protection and thus, the general paint quantity required.

  • Pearlescent Paints

    Pearlescent paints make the most of ceramic crystals to create a shimmering, iridescent impact. These complicated formulations usually require specialised utility methods and a number of coats to attain the specified depth and luminosity. This elevated layering ends in larger paint consumption in comparison with strong and even metallic paints. Furthermore, variations in pearl dimension and focus can considerably influence protection and the required variety of coats, influencing the ultimate paint amount.

  • Specialty Finishes

    Specialty finishes, like sweet paints or matte finishes, current distinctive challenges and infrequently require important paint quantity. Sweet paints contain layering translucent colours over a metallic basecoat, demanding a number of coats for depth and vibrancy. Matte finishes, whereas typically showing easier, can spotlight floor imperfections, necessitating meticulous preparation and doubtlessly a number of coats for a easy, uniform outcome. These specialised necessities additional underscore the hyperlink between paint sort and the general amount required.

6. Utility Technique

The tactic employed to use paint considerably impacts the quantity required for automotive portray. Completely different utility strategies exhibit various efficiencies, affecting materials utilization and general mission price. Understanding these variations is essential for correct paint estimation and reaching a desired end high quality.

  • Spray Utility

    Spray utility, using specialised tools like HVLP (Excessive Quantity Low Strain) spray weapons or airbrushes, typically presents larger switch effectivity in comparison with different strategies. This implies a better share of the paint reaches the goal floor, minimizing overspray and lowering waste. Skilled auto physique outlets predominantly make use of spray utility for its capacity to attain uniform protection and easy finishes, significantly with metallic or pearlescent paints. Nonetheless, the preliminary funding in tools and the necessity for correct air flow and security precautions should be thought of.

  • Brush Utility

    Brushing, a extra conventional technique, includes making use of paint on to the floor utilizing brushes of various sizes and bristle sorts. Whereas comparatively easy and requiring minimal tools funding, brushing tends to lead to decrease switch effectivity in comparison with spraying. A good portion of the paint might be absorbed by the comb or misplaced as a consequence of dripping, rising the general quantity required. Brushing is usually appropriate for smaller areas, touch-ups, or initiatives the place spray utility is impractical. Nonetheless, reaching a easy, even end might be difficult, significantly on bigger surfaces.

  • Curler Utility

    Curler utility, utilizing foam or microfiber rollers, presents a compromise between spraying and brushing. It permits for comparatively even protection over bigger areas with out the necessity for specialised spray tools. Nonetheless, curler utility can nonetheless lead to better paint utilization in comparison with spraying, significantly on complicated shapes or textured surfaces. Curler marks or stippling may also happen if not utilized fastidiously. This technique might be appropriate for DIY initiatives or conditions the place a easy end is much less crucial, comparable to undercoating or making use of primer.

  • Dip Coating

    Dip coating, usually used for smaller elements or elements, includes submerging the thing fully in a tank of paint. Whereas reaching full protection and constant movie thickness, dip coating sometimes requires a big quantity of paint to fill the tank. This technique is much less frequent for total automobile portray because of the logistical challenges and potential for extreme paint utilization. Nonetheless, it stays a viable possibility for specialised purposes, comparable to making use of a protecting coating to undercarriage elements or refinishing smaller elements like wheels.

Suggestions for Optimizing Automotive Paint Utilization

Optimizing paint utilization contributes to price financial savings and minimizes environmental influence. The next suggestions present sensible steering for environment friendly paint utility and reaching skilled outcomes.

Tip 1: Correct Floor Space Calculation:

Exactly calculating the automobile’s floor space ensures correct paint estimation. Using on-line calculators or consulting producer tips offers dependable floor space estimations based mostly on automobile make and mannequin. Correct measurements forestall materials shortages or extreme surplus.

Tip 2: Thorough Floor Preparation:

Correct floor preparation, together with cleansing, sanding, and priming, creates a easy, uniform substrate for optimum paint adhesion. This minimizes paint absorption and ensures even protection, lowering the required quantity of topcoat. Addressing imperfections like rust or dents earlier than portray prevents rework and optimizes paint utilization.

Tip 3: Acceptable Paint Choice:

Choosing high-quality paint with superior protection minimizes the required variety of coats, lowering general paint consumption. Consulting product datasheets and searching for knowledgeable recommendation ensures applicable paint choice for the precise mission and desired end.

Tip 4: Environment friendly Utility Strategies:

Using environment friendly utility methods, comparable to utilizing an HVLP spray gun with applicable settings, maximizes switch effectivity and minimizes overspray. Sustaining constant spray gun distance and pace ensures uniform protection and reduces paint waste. Practising on check panels optimizes approach and minimizes materials utilization in the course of the precise mission.

Tip 5: Strategic Paint Mixing and Thinning:

Precisely mixing paint elements and thinning to the producer’s advisable viscosity ensures optimum sprayability and protection. Avoiding extreme thinning prevents runs and sags, minimizing rework and paint waste. Correct mixing methods guarantee constant shade and end.

Tip 6: Optimized Spray Gun Setup:

Correct spray gun setup, together with deciding on the suitable nozzle dimension and air stress, optimizes atomization and paint move. Common cleansing and upkeep of the spray gun guarantee constant efficiency and forestall clogs, minimizing paint waste and guaranteeing uniform utility.

Tip 7: Managed Environmental Situations:

Sustaining managed environmental situations, comparable to secure temperature and humidity, ensures optimum paint drying and minimizes potential points like orange peel or blushing. Correct air flow prevents solvent buildup and promotes uniform drying, lowering the necessity for rework and optimizing paint utilization.
